For 30 years, Vincent Gigante pretends to be insane to evade justice, but behind the crazy act lurks the vicious, scheming, murdering boss of one of New York's five crime families.
Henry Hill, a wannabe mobster, sets up the biggest heist in American history to that point, but can't fully cash in because he isn't Italian; he never sees the icy treachery behind the facade and must become a rat to survive.
The Mob welcomes Anthony "Gaspipe" Casso, a brutal thug with a love of violence, with open arms; he makes millions for them, and for himself, but he grows severely paranoid.
Carmine "the Snake" Persico, a master of deceit, commits one of the biggest murders in Mafia history; while behind bars he rules a crime family, conducts three wars and orders murders.
Sammy "the Bull" Gravano, a vicious hit man with 19 murders to his name, runs a string of lucrative businesses and becomes the loyal and extremely dangerous underboss of New York's biggest crime family.
John Gotti murders his way to the top of New York's most powerful Mafia family; indictments come and go, but nothing sticks; rich, powerful and in love with himself, Gotti becomes enthralled with the glare of the media lights.
